Some payment plans are interest-free, while others carry rates that add meaningfully to the total cost.
Missed payments can trigger fees or even cancel your reservation, depending on the provider's terms.
Some plans quietly increase the total price compared to paying in full at booking.
Some package payment plans are run by third-party lenders, not the travel company itself, which affects dispute resolution.
Missing a final payment deadline close to departure can jeopardize your trip.
Cancellation policies can differ between a payment-plan booking and a standard paid-in-full reservation.
